I just finished watching "Daasi" and it's like 50% of me thinks it a really good drama and other 50% thinks its gross...


The starting few episodes were too good, I really liked Sunehri's character and I think Mawra played it quite nicely. But I didn't like Aliya i.e. Faryal's acting at all, someone else could have played Aliya's character much better.


So basically Aahil was so angry with his mother that he left his luxurious life. But what I didn't understand was how and why did he go back to her then? Just because she rescued you from the jail. I really didn't understand that part.


Also, where did his passion for mucic go? I was really hoping that he will make a career in music in the later episodes but that never happened...


I also feel that Aliya's hatred was not justified... I really didn't find any logic in her hatred for Sunehri ...


One more thing which I extremely disliked about this drama was that it somehow promoted violence. I mean okay Aliya was wrong but that didn't give Adil any right to hit her.


Anddd, I don't know if anyone can relate or not... But... I really, really liked Mujtaba so much and I was so sad when he died. I actually liked him since the first episode and I literally thought of an alternate story where Sunehri and Mujtaba would be the couple


The ending of the drama could have been much better....

At first, I found Daasi to be a good show and it was being bashed because of the bandwagon mentality; one "big" reviewer bashes, so everyone feels that they should also hate the show. I, however, continued watching and I was enjoying the initial episodes. As far as acting goes, it wasn't really the best acting done but it depends heavily on the director. He's the one who kept making Sunehri seem so annoying when she kept referring to herself in 3rd person and stuff. Faryal didn't do all that stellar either, as you said.
The whole Aahil and his mother track seemed a bit messy towards the end but I think the biggest reason he forgave his mother was that Sunehri had convinced him to, no? They did focus on music to an extent since that other girl told him about how he could expand his career in music but that track got sidelined; it could have actually made for a really good track on the side or even a main track for a few episodes. I also found Aliya's hatred stupid.. she did nothing but hold a grudge! They showed her hate so overdramatic that at times it felt unreal, lol. And yes. I agree about the violence. It got so uncomfortable to watch after a point when he was beating Aliya in nearly every episode. I feel that they didn't have to show that as they could shown he hurt her with words, or even silence to give a good message, instead of him abusing her. I found the Mujtaba twist unnecessary. He could have become the villain or even a saviour for Sunehri, instead of having to kill him. The ending was fine. I mean I can't really think of what else they could have done for the ending. It was a happy ending for both Aahil and Sunehri, which I think everyone wanted.
